XL 2016 Détecter et numéroter des chevauchements de périodes

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

FranckEly

XLDnaute Nouveau
Bonjour,

Malgré mes recherches, je ne trouve pas de solution à mon problème.
Voilà le détail de mon tableau :
En A, une date et une heure de début
En B, une date et une heure de fin
En D, le nom d'une société
En E, le numéro d'un étage
En F, le numéro d'une zone sur l'étage

L'objectif est de détecter les périodes qui se chevauchent pour un même niveau et une même zone et, de les numéroter dans la colonne C.
J'ai trouvé le moyen de les détecter mais je ne parviens pas à les numéroter.
Avec la formule présente, cela fonctionne évidemment que si je n'ai qu'un seul chevauchement.
La première période aura en colonne C le numéro d'ordre 1 et la seconde la numéro 2.
Je souhaite que la suivante est le numéro 3 et ainsi de suite.

Merci d'avance
 

Pièces jointes

Dernière édition:
Bonjour à tous,

Un essai avec ce que je comprends.
VB:
=SI(ET(A4<=PETITE.VALEUR(SI(($E$4:$E$10=$E4)*($F$4:$F$10=$F4);$A$4:$A$10);1);B4>=GRANDE.VALEUR(SI(($E$4:$E$10=$E4)*($F$4:$F$10=$F4);$B$4:$B$10);1));1;MAX(SI(($E$4:$E$4=$E4)*($F$4:$F$4=$F4);$C$3:$C3)+1))
Formule matricielle à valider par Ctrl+Maj+Entrée
Copier vers le bas

JHA
 

Pièces jointes

Bonjour à tous,

Un essai avec ce que je comprends.
VB:
=SI(ET(A4<=PETITE.VALEUR(SI(($E$4:$E$10=$E4)*($F$4:$F$10=$F4);$A$4:$A$10);1);B4>=GRANDE.VALEUR(SI(($E$4:$E$10=$E4)*($F$4:$F$10=$F4);$B$4:$B$10);1));1;MAX(SI(($E$4:$E$4=$E4)*($F$4:$F$4=$F4);$C$3:$C3)+1))
Formule matricielle à valider par Ctrl+Maj+Entrée
Copier vers le bas

JHA

En fait, j'ai poussé un peu plus loin mes tests et, il subsiste un problème.
Cela ne fonctionne pas dans tous les cas.
Je joins le fichier ou j'ai simplement modifié les numéros de zones par rapport à l'original et je me rends compte que la formule ne détecte pas un chevauchement de périodes.
Je cherche à comprendre le fonctionnement de la formule pour la modifier/compléter mais je n'y suis pas encore.
 

Pièces jointes

-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

  • Question Question
Réponses
22
Affichages
1 K
Retour